popback函数也可以被称为弹出函数或拆取函数,是一种非常有用的函数,被广泛应用于一系列数据结构,如栈,队列,向量等。 Popback函数的定义 popback函数是一种定义在C++中的函数,它用于从某个数据结构中移除元素,并返回该元素的值。它可以用于一些特定的数据结构,如栈、队列、容器等,它的定义如下: template<typename...
`pop_back`函数用于删除容器中的最后一个元素,并返回该元素的值。如果容器为空,`pop_back`函数会返回一个特殊的值,如`std::vector::pop_back()`会返回一个空指针。这个特殊的值可以帮助你在调用`pop_back`之前判断容器是否为空。 三、使用场景 1. 删除最后一个元素:这是`pop_back`最常见的使用场景。当你...
vec.pop_back(); std::cout << "Size after pop_back: " << vec.getSize() << std::endl; return 0; } 以上是一个简单的自定义向量类的示例,其中包含了push_back和pop_back函数。pop_back函数会从向量的末尾删除一个元素,并更新向量的大小。在实际使用中,还可以根据需要扩展该类的功能,例如实现迭代...
popback函数在使用上要遵守一定的步骤。首先,开发者需要创建一个容器来存储数据,如vector<int> vec;。之后,可以使用push_back函数将元素添加进容器中。最后,可以使用popback函数从容器中删除最后一个元素,如vec.pop_back();。 popback函数的具体用法及示例可以参考官方说明文档,或者从在线社区中获取相关资料,以便开发...
popback函数是C++标准库std中提供的一种功能,它能够快速地从容器中删除最后一个元素,而不用进行大量的操作。具体来说,它能够将最后一个元素从容器中移除,并将其返回给调用者,而不会影响容器中其他元素的顺序或内容。 popback函数具有多种应用场景,例如管理和维护字符串、数组、队列和栈等数据结构的元素。举例来说...
pop_back()的用法及运行机制 vector在c++中非常好用,简单的说,vector是一个能够存放任意类型的动态数组,能够增加和压缩数据。 一般使用push_back()和pop_back()函数将数据存放进容器末尾。 如下例程: #include <iostream> #include <vector> using namespace std;...
string中的pop_back()函数 1.头文件:#include<cstring> 2.string s; s.pop_back() 表示删除字符串末尾的数字 __EOF__
单链表的PushBack,PopBack,Insert...函数,单链表的熟悉使用,注意测试用例的全面//使用引用的作用等同于使用二级指针,在传递指针时//传引用是可能改变Link,而有的函数只需改变->next,此时不需传引用#include<stdio.h>#include<malloc.h>#include<st
当前标签:string中的pop_back()函数 miao-xixixi 取其精华,弃其糟粕
是指将pop函数作为一个无返回值的回调函数传递给另一个函数。在这种情况下,当特定条件满足时,另一个函数会调用pop函数来执行特定的操作。 回调函数是一种常见的编程模式,用于在异步操作完成后执行特定的...